St Thomas never trails as they dominate the Johnnies tonight. Keating has a very good game, 15 and 11 with 6 dimes, as hes one of four Tommie starters in double figures. Big contributions from those outside of "The Big 3" were integral in the blowout. Robinsons productivity from the semis carried over to this game (11 pts), and Tuma (7 pts) played quality minutes filling in for a foul plagued Dwyer. Rosefelt and Schnettler were effective, though Rosefelt was bumped around quite a bit and that hampered his ability to get to the rim. Schnettler earned a lot of his off penetration. Tommies took very good care of the ball, and maintained a great pace on the offensive end. On the defensive end of the floor, UST pestered the perimeter and was challenging almost every shot the Johnnies took (1-16 from 3, 33% from the field overall). Nice bounce back, in terms of defensive intensity, from the semis, though they will have to box out a lot better and limit second chance points (15 O Bds).

Westman and Lieser were complete no-shows, in a repeat of their atrocious performance last Saturday. C Schafer again had a good game, but didnt get nearly enough touches from his teammates. Thats the problem when your offense is based on your outside scorers creating opportunity for your posts. As weve seen the last two times at the Shoe, it really doesnt work against a team that plays solid D like the Tommies. Ohme, who played hard, was out of control and ineffective. Brink, who I read in the days leading up to tonights game would be the "X-Factor", did absolutely nothing, and the bench of SJU was outplayed and outworked by the UST subs overall. It was Fogt who kept SJU afloat in the 1st half with 8 points, before UST took over completely and didnt look back.
